Experience Comfort and Adventure at the 3-Star Yosemite Basecamp Hotel

The Yosemite Basecamp Hotel is a 3-star accommodation that promises a unique blend of comfort and outdoor excitement. Revered for its proximity to stunning natural landscapes, this Groveland hotel serves as the perfect basecamp for adventurers and nature lovers alike. With key amenities designed to enhance your stay, the hotel offers a distinctive experience among Groveland lodging options.

Comfort Meets Style in Our Rooms

The Yosemite Basecamp Hotel features accommodations that blend rustic charm with modern convenience. Rooms are thoughtfully appointed to ensure a restful night's sleep after a day of exploration. Each space is designed to cater to the needs of adventurers, with comfortable bedding and ample storage for gear.

Delight in Locally Inspired Dining at Yosemite Basecamp Hotel

Dining at the hotel is an experience in itself, showcasing American dishes influenced by California sensibilities. Fresh, thoughtful, and environmentally sound ingredients are at the forefront, guaranteeing meals that are not only delicious but also resonate with the local culture.

Services Tailored for the Outdoor Enthusiast

This hotel stands out for its comprehensive services catering to outdoor enthusiasts. The Basecamp Outfitter is your one-stop-shop for adventure needs, offering guided adventures, a full-service fly shop, and essential outdoor gear. Plus, all adventures come with equipment, fees, licenses, and transportation included, along with a variety of locally sourced add-ons to customize your day.

Unparalleled Entertainment and Recreation

Entertainment and recreation opportunities abound, with options for guests to engage in sightseeing through Yosemite Valley, mountain biking in Stanislaus National Forest, or enjoying leisurely walks among Yosemite's iconic landmarks. Whether opting for a backcountry hike or a high country float tube adventure, the hotel provides the perfect backdrop for an unforgettable day spent in nature.

Yosemite Basecamp Hotel: Prime Location & Easy Transportation

Located 95 km from Modesto City-County, this 3-star hotel offers easy access to breathtaking natural wonders. Its prime location ensures convenience for guests looking to explore Yosemite Valley, Stanislaus National Forest, and other attractions. Transportation services enhance the experience, making it effortless for guests to navigate the area's renowned sights.
